Hari Raya is always sweeter with duit Raya, and for eight-year-old Jebat Jayden – son of local actor Sharnaaz Ahmad and his ex-wife Noor Nabila – this year’s haul is nothing short of impressive.
In an Instagram Story, the young boy revealed that his festive collection reached a staggering RM18,369.
The cash, stacked mainly in RM50 and RM100 notes, was kept in a simple plastic container.
Adding to the festive cheer, Jebat also received several gold bars weighing 1g and 10g.
It’s understood that his gifts came from close relatives, including his aunt, renowned actress and entrepreneur Neelofa.

For the record, Sharnaaz, 40, and Nabila, 41, married on March 31, 2017, and divorced on July 9, 2020, remaining on good terms as they co-parent their son Jebat.
While Sharnaaz has stayed single since, Nabila later married local entrepreneur Engku Emran Engku Zainal Abidin in 2021, though the marriage ended in divorce in 2023.
